Manufacturing facility KTM rider has vowed to finish the 2026 Dakar Rally except “somebody drags me out” after nursing a damaged collarbone throughout Stage 10.
The reigning champion arrived within the second a part of the marathon stage in Bisha main the general standings, holding a snug 6m24s buffer over Honda rival .

Nevertheless, catastrophe struck round one-third of the best way by the 368km particular when Sanders crashed within the dunes, injuring his left shoulder.
Regardless of the ache, the Australian remounted his KTM with help from Brabec and dragged the bike to the end in 4h33m33s – a outstanding effort on a stage dominated by gentle sand and round 100km of dunes.
“It appears to be like like a snapped collarbone, for certain,” he informed reporters together with Motorsport.com. “On the refuel, we checked it, but it surely occurred at 140km.

“I went over a dune and it was fairly scary. I almost landed on Tosha [Schareina] and all of us missed it. However I received up and knew the collarbone was damaged and likewise the sternum [bone]. I’ve damaged this as properly, so there isn’t any energy.”
The crash has successfully ended Sanders’ hope of defending his Dakar title, with the 31-year-old conceding 27 minutes over the course of the stage – a large margin in an ultra-competitive bikes class.
He has slipped to fourth within the general standings, 17 minutes behind new chief Brabec.

Sanders initially stated he would seek the advice of together with his crew earlier than deciding whether or not to proceed, however shortly made it clear that he needs to complete the rally.
“It wasn’t good within the dunes in any respect,” he stated. “However sadly, we have let the rally go now. We’ll return to the crew and re-evaluate the accidents and the state of affairs and see if it is secure to proceed.
“I needed to proceed and I would not have completed at present if I did not need to proceed.

“If I’ve simply executed 150km within the sand dunes, it should not be too dangerous. It is all rocks now, so I can simply arise and cruise alongside.
“I feel if it was sand dunes, it might be robust, however now we’re type of executed with the dunes, it is on the gravel roads, it is a bit of bit simpler. However we’ll see.”
He added: “We do not stop. Mum and Dad did not increase ‘no quitter’, so I am not pulling out now till another person tells me to tug out or they drag me out of the race, so I am not stopping.”

Sanders had led nearly all of the rally till Stage 10, however his accident means KTM’s victory hopes now relaxation with . The Argentine trails new general chief Brabec by 56 seconds with 4 levels nonetheless remaining.
